(TOLEDO, Ohio - May 31, 2012) - It’s the race that’s described by race fans as a “can’t miss race, you have to see it in person” and on and on.  It’s the All American Coach “Fastest Short Track Show in the World,” starring the Town Money Saver MSA Winged Super Modifieds and the winged Auto Value/Bumper to Bumper Super Sprints (AVBBSS)!  Created by Toledo track management, the event has become one of the top open-wheel pavement races in the country.  Time trials have taken on a name of its own, as the 2 groups vie for supremacy---who has the fastest race car on the planet!  The date is Friday, June 15.

Defending race winners for the All American Coach Fastest Short Track Show in the World are veteran Bobby Dawson in the MSA Super Modifieds and hometown favorite Jimmy McCune for the AVBBSS Sprints.

Arriving early to see practice and perhaps the most exciting qualifying session at a short track in the nation is a must!  If the track record is to be broken this year, it will take an unprecedented effort!  In the 2011 time trials, an incredible lap of 12:389 was set by AVBBSS Sprint driver Charlie Schultz in a car fielded by Dick Myers. 

With the pedal to the metal, and everyone on the track grounds holding their breath, Schultz ripped off a lap that will be etched in the minds of race fans for many years to come!  And an amazing 7 drivers dipped into the 12 second bracket on the lightning-fast ½ mile paved oval!  Schultz also established another milestone in this classic event by also setting fast time for the MSA Super Modifieds.

img9840.jpgThe MSA Super Modifieds ran their 40 lap feature without a yellow flag in the 2011 edition of the event, as Bobby Dawson grabbed the win in a record 9 minutes and 34 seconds.  Schultz and Johnny Benson were on the move as the laps wound down but ran out of time. 

Schultz came from the 10th starting spot and had the lead in the Sprint feature  by lap 14, only to have a tire go flat the next lap.  Toledo native Jimmy McCune picked up the point and sped to the very popular victory in the 30 lap main event.
